Transaction 72ddb5067911759eaddeff03492bc48731c4dd3b7dfefc02111efe85175fef13

1 Input
2 Outputs
  • 72ddb5067911759eaddeff03492bc48731c4dd3b7dfefc02111efe85175fef13:0
  • value  143000
    address  3Fo8iE4U3xreJKEkvwCD3HttnMPmP1MSnG
  • 72ddb5067911759eaddeff03492bc48731c4dd3b7dfefc02111efe85175fef13:1
  • value  4468596035
    address  3BWZ9uPyuUnrwVwDGuBYvUfQHtHv23YZEJ